The Use of Video Brochures in Promotional Campaigns

In the highly competitive world of marketing, where capturing the attention of potential customers is a constant challenge, businesses are continually seeking innovative ways to stand out and make a lasting impression. One such method that has gained significant traction in recent years is the use of video brochures. These unique promotional tools combine the elegance of traditional print brochures with the engaging power of digital media, offering a host of benefits that can significantly enhance the effectiveness of promotional campaigns.

One of the most notable advantages of video brochures is their ability to capture and retain attention. In a world where consumers are bombarded with information from various sources, a static brochure or a generic advertisement can easily be overlooked. However, a video brochure with its built-in screen and dynamic content immediately grabs attention, creating a memorable first impression. The combination of visuals, audio, and motion creates a multi-sensory experience that is far more engaging than traditional print materials, making it more likely that the recipient will take the time to explore the content.

Video brochures also excel in conveying complex information in an easy-to-understand format. Whether it’s a product demonstration, a company overview, or a detailed service offering, the use of video allows businesses to break down complex concepts into digestible chunks. This not only makes the information more accessible but also increases the likelihood that the recipient will retain the key points. In a promotional campaign, this can be invaluable in ensuring that potential customers fully understand the value proposition of the product or service being offered.

Another significant benefit of video brochures is their versatility. They can be customized to suit a wide range of promotional needs, from product launches and trade shows to corporate events and direct mail campaigns. The ability to tailor the content to specific audiences or occasions ensures that the message is relevant and impactful, increasing the chances of a positive response. Moreover, video brochures can be easily updated or reprogrammed, allowing businesses to keep their promotional materials fresh and up-to-date without the need for costly reprints.

In addition to their promotional value, video brochures also serve as powerful branding tools. They provide an opportunity for businesses to showcase their creativity, innovation, and commitment to quality. By incorporating brand colors, logos, and messaging into the design, video brochures help to reinforce brand identity and create a cohesive brand experience. This can be particularly beneficial in building brand recognition and loyalty among target audiences.

From a practical standpoint, video brochures are also highly portable and easy to distribute. They can be handed out at events, included in direct mail packages, or even left at strategic locations for potential customers to pick up. Their compact size and lightweight design make them convenient to carry and transport, ensuring that they can reach a wide audience without the logistical challenges associated with larger promotional materials.
